I hunted around the hitchhiker and critter I.D. forums for a while now and haven’t seen anything like this, if it’s there and I missed it I apologize. I turned off the blue light for this picture, critter in question is to the right of the little gsp clump. Antler looking thing started from essentially nothing around 6 months ago and is now roughly 6cm long. It is rigid, sways under the random flow generator a bit like a tree branch in wind.
